The stage is set. Liverpool stands on the brink of glory, needing just a single point against Tottenham Hotspur to clinch their 20th English top-flight title. The air is thick with anticipation. Fans are buzzing, but the players remain grounded. Manager Arne Slot has his eyes on the prize but knows better than to count his chickens before they hatch.

Tottenham, on the other hand, is a ship sailing through stormy seas. They will head to Anfield without their captain, Son Heung-min, who is nursing a foot injury. His absence is a gaping hole in the Spurs lineup. The South Korean forward has been a beacon of hope for the team, but now they must navigate these treacherous waters without him. Manager Ange Postecoglou is optimistic, hoping to have Son back for the Europa League semi-final against Bodo/Glimt. But first, they must face the league leaders.

Liverpool's journey this season has been a rollercoaster. Under Slot's leadership, they have transformed into a formidable force. The team has shown resilience, battling through injuries and tough matches. Their recent draw against Crystal Palace has put them in a prime position. With 79 points from 34 matches, they are on the cusp of history. A single point against Spurs will etch their name alongside Manchester United in the record books.
